Step into a rewarding contract opportunity as a part-time Speech-Language Pathologist Assistant (SLPA) for the upcoming 2026-2027 school year. Support students and make an impact by providing quality speech and language services in a role that offers meaningful connections and flexibility, working just 10-12 hours per week across a 10.5-month school calendar.

Key Qualifications:

  • Current SLPA license or eligibility to practice as an SLPA in Pennsylvania
  • Previous experience supporting Speech-Language Pathologists in school settings
  • Strong understanding of speech and language development, assessments, and interventions
  • Familiarity or experience with teletherapy platforms and practices
  • Comfort adapting to both in-person and remote service delivery as needed
  • Excellent communication, collaboration, and documentation skills
  • Must hold professionalism and confidentiality to high standards

What You’ll Do:

  • Implement therapy plans developed by the supervising SLP to address students’ individualized education goals
  • Conduct group and one-on-one speech-language sessions under supervision
  • Support with conducting informal assessments and gathering data on student progress
  • Utilize teletherapy tools and resources to reach students who require remote services
  • Maintain detailed records of therapy sessions, attendance, and progress
  • Collaborate with teaching staff, families, and the SLP to foster student success and engagement
  • Participate in relevant trainings or meetings upon request
